Idk man! You got it for a great price, and I love the rear! I think it looks awesome! It looks pretty much OEM except for the nice looking air tunnels on the side and the lower rectangle. It doesnt look ricey at all to me, the front mayjust a TAD bit but IMHO I would put it on if I had one! Though, it is fiberglass....so you have to be careful.

One thing is that I have seen a few fiberglass fronts that have rock chips in them which loom pretty bad. However, if I ever got a kit there is a film maybe by 3m but I am not positive on that one? Anyways, its a clear film that protects paint from small rocks traveling up to 50 mph.

yea the front was a lil banged up and had a 6 inch crack and the fiberglass, probably from a speed bump or something, it's at the fiberglass shop now being completly refurbished, i do like it, one thing that concerns me though is my cars stance, if i put it on i would surly have to raise my coilovers up to get clearance for it, and my wheel and tires package is setup for no wheel well gap and when i raise it up i would have tons of gap there, meaning i would have to get bigger tires
